Description:
These two volumes comprise of entries from Margaret Fountaine's diaries interspersed with comments and accounts from the editor. Margaret Elizabeth Fountaine (1862–1940) was an English lepidopterist, traveller & explorer, whose passion for butterflies took her around the world, venturing intrepidly into remote areas of the Middle East, Africa, the Americas, Australia, and more. For much of the way she was accompanied by Khalil, her loyal Syrian lover, and a fellow butterfly enthusiast.
